Aims and Objectives

Aims

The Department of Computer Science aims to provide a strong foundation in computing principles, foster innovation and research, and prepare students to meet the technological demands of the modern world. We are committed to producing skilled professionals who can contribute to the advancement of science, industry, and society through technology

Objectives

1.Deliver Quality Education in Computing::

Offer a curriculum that balances theoretical knowledge and practical application across areas like programming, data structures, algorithms, artificial intelligence, and cybersecurity.

2.Encourage Innovation and Research::

Promote inquiry-based learning and support research initiatives that contribute to technological advancement and problem-solving in real-world scenarios

3.Equip Students with Industry-Relevant Skills:

Develop students’ technical proficiency and problem-solving abilities through hands-on experience, internships, and project-based learning.

4.Foster Ethical and Responsible Computing:

Instill professional ethics, data privacy awareness, and social responsibility in the development and application of technology.

5.Promote Lifelong Learning:

Encourage continuous skill enhancement and adaptability in a rapidly evolving technological landscape.

6.Strengthen Industry-Academia Collaboration:

Build partnerships with industry leaders to align academic outcomes with market needs and emerging trends.

7.Support Entrepreneurship and Innovation:

Nurture creative thinking and entrepreneurial spirit to empower students to create technology-driven solutions and startups.

8.Develop Global Competence:

Prepare students for global careers by integrating international standards and emerging technologies in computing.
